AI Summary
-
Requires the Civil Rights Department to establish a pilot program by January 1, 2025 to recognize businesses that create discrimination and harassment-free environments for customers.
-
Sets qualification criteria for businesses including demonstrating compliance with the Unruh Civil Rights Act (Section 51), providing employee training, informing customers of their rights, and establishing codes of conduct.
-
Directs the department to issue certificates to qualifying businesses and maintain a public database of certified businesses on its website.
-
Requires the department to evaluate the pilot program's effectiveness by January 1, 2028, assessing whether it affects customer behavior, incentivizes business compliance, or reduces discrimination and harassment incidents.
-
Specifies that pilot program recognition does not establish any legal defense against civil rights claims and automatically repeals on July 1, 2028.
